GAA: All this weekend's fixtures and where to watch

There's a big schedule of sport for the June bank holiday weekend, with championship action across football, hurling and camogie.

The main events of the weekend are undoubtedly the provincial hurling deciders in Munster and Leinster. Neighbours Clare and Limerick face off for the second time in the space of four weeks in the Munster affair down in Thurles, while old rivals Galway and Kilkenny meet in Croke Park.

Here's all this weekend's GAA fixtures and which games are being televised...
